Mousehole is a beautiful fishing harbour and seaside holiday village in Cornwall located near Penzance, Lands End and St Ives on the southwestern coast of England. It is known for its narrow, winding streets, it's beach, and its picturesque, thatched-roof cottages that line the harbour. The village has a rich history dating back to the 16th century, and it was once an important port for the export of tin, copper, and other minerals.
Mousehole is also renowned for its festivals and events, including the Christmas Mousehole harbour lights display, which attracts visitors from all over the country. The village is surrounded by stunning natural beauty, with cliffs, beaches, and coves in every direction, making it a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ers. There are several trails for walking and hiking, as well as opportunities for water sports such as kayaking, surfing, and diving.
In addition to its natural beauty, Mousehole is home to several unique shops, galleries, and restaurants that specialise in local cuisine, arts, and crafts. The village also has a strong community spirit, with local residents actively involved in preserving its heritage and maintaining its traditional character.
